Can my product be approved by BHA?

17 Jul 14

No.

Any advice given is simply to highlight if there are any particular issues in relation to a particular product and its use under the BHA Rules of Racing. BHA may advise trainers and their veterinary surgeons or feed supplement manufactures if a particular ingredient is a Prohibited Substance. BHA’s advice must not be quoted on any product literature, but feed supplement manufacturers can refer to BHA’s written advice, if given in full, in direct dialogue with trainers and their veterinary surgeons.

Please note the Jockey Club no longer regulates British horseracing, so reference to approval by the Jockey Club or similar, or indeed approved by racing authorities, have no meaning.
